Robust Security Measures
Security is paramount when handling sensitive financial information. A reliable client portal should include advanced encryption, multi-factor authentication, and regular security updates to protect data from unauthorized access. Ensuring your portal complies with industry standards such as GDPR or HIPAA can also provide peace of mind for both you and your clients.
User-Friendly Interface
An int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face encourages clients to actively use the portal and reduces time spent on support queries. Look for a design that simplifies document uploads, messaging, and accessing reports so that clients of all tech levels feel comfortable using it.
Seamless Document Management
Efficient document storage and management are crucial features in a client portal for accountants. The ability to organize files by category or date, track document versions, and quickly search through records improves workflow productivity. Integration with tax software or accounting tools can further enhance this capability.
Real-Time Communication Tools
Effective communication is key to maintaining strong relationships with clients. Client portals featuring real-time chat options, secure messaging systems, or automated notifications keep everyone informed about deadlines, updates, or requests without relying on less secure email exchanges.
Customizable Client Access Levels
Different clients have different needs regarding what they should see or interact with in the portal. Having customizable access controls allows accountants to tailor permissions based on each client’s preferences or confidentiality requirements while safeguarding sensitive information appropriately.
